Night shift: evacuation-chair store on Stairwell C, Level 3, was restocked today. Two Havermont chairs serviced, one sent to Drayle Safety for repair. Check the seal on the store door at 02:00 rounds. If the seal is broken, log it and re-secure. Door access for the store uses the pass below.

staff pass of fajop-kajop = bdg-H-83

**Q: Why do my builds on Fernwick agents fail with timestamp errors?**

Clock skew between build agents is a known issue in the Fernwick pool. Agents sync against our internal time service every ten minutes, but drift of up to two seconds can occur between syncs, which breaks artifact signing in Cadrelle CI. Before filing a ticket, please review the skew troubleshooting guide on the internal page below.

wiki page, tahaf-tajog: https://jira.ordindyn.corp/pipeline

- [ ] Step 7: Archive cold storage buckets (Glacierline tier). Confirm both ceremony witnesses are present, verify bucket manifests match the Oxbow ledger, then seal the archive key shares. Plugin authors may observe but not handle shares. Once sealed, the archive index itself is encrypted and can only be reopened with the passphrase below.

vault phrase of badup-hahig = tamael-aldael-kelmir-istael-fenok-istwyn-tamius-jorath-oliion

## Plugin access on WikiBarn

If you're building a plugin for WikiBarn, heads up: role checks happen before your hooks fire. Editors can touch page content, Stewards can rename namespaces, and only Wardens can change plugin settings. Don't try to sneak around this by caching tokens — the gatekeeper re-validates on every call. If your plugin needs elevated rights, request a scoped service role from the Greywick team. The roles map to these settings, which are as follows:

deployment values, taweg-bajop:
[fenvan]
port = 5672
team = holmir
host = fenvan.orvexio.example
region = lower-1
access_code = ac_b98bc6
timeout_ms = 1500